Hiring this contractor was one of the biggest mistakes I have ever made. I hired him to retile and renovate a bathroom and it turned into a two month nightmare. This bathroom remodel started off as an $1800 job. Dennis Matthews, the owner and contractor said he was eager to do the job. Through our initial meeting and correspondence he was was friendly and helpful. He showed up on day one and started doing some demo with a worker he brought. A couple hours into the job he explained how he suddenly needed to raise the price thousands of dollars but he would do a more substantial renovation. (I later found it peculiar that he didn't show up with a contract to sign until after he raised the price.) The same day his worker knocked a hole into my bedroom, knocked a hole my adjoining closet and made a huge spark taking a light fixture out, blowing the dimmer switch. Dennis tries to up sell me on ways to repair the damage. I dont want to spend the time to go into every detail but suffice it to say this man was unstable, prone to outbursts, and would pry into my personal information. For instance, in the case of the dimmer switch he blew, Dennis tried to replace it with a scratched up piece of trash he had in the back of his truck and literally yelled about it several times, without me even bringing it up, how my dimmer was worth nothing and he was replacing it with a $70 dimmer. This was the time I started coming to realize I was dealing with a mentally unstable person. Every day having this man in my apartment was stressful. He'd come late, he'd leave early. He almost never do what he said he was going to do. He would talk about his twenty years of experience but would install wall framing that was not straight and try to brace the framing to temporary installations on the walls of my neighbors adjoining apt. He'd yell at me when I tried to talk about details of the job and say how He didn't even have a minute to discuss details and then go smoke cigarettes. After he completely bumbled the plumbing and nothing was where it needed to be or working properly, he shook me down for more money. The next week he ultimately packed up all his tools with no warning when I only owed him a couple hundred bucks and left the job completely in shambles. The only thing worse than the work he didn't complete was the work he did. I've never in my life seen such bad tiling and grouting. He put in brand new walls so the tile would be straight. The new walls were not straight at all. The spacing was uneven, the edges were jagged uneven and didnt match. The grout was such an unbelievable mess that looked like a 3 year old had done it.
